为了账号安全,请及时绑定邮箱和手机立即绑定
慕课网数字资源数据库体验端
初识Python_学习笔记_慕课网
为了账号安全,请及时绑定邮箱和手机立即绑定

初识Python

廖雪峰 移动开发工程师
难度入门
时长 5小时 0分
  • dict的第一个特点是查找速度快,无论dict有10个元素还是10万个元素,查找速度都一样。而list的查找速度随着元素增加而逐渐下降。 dict的第二个特点就是存储的key-value序对是没有顺序的!这和list不一样: dict的第三个特点是作为 key 的元素必须不可变,Python的基本类型如字符串、整数、浮点数都是不可变的,都可以作为 key。但是list是可变的,就不能作为 key。
    查看全部
  • dict的第一个特点是查找速度快,无论dict有10个元素还是10万个元素,查找速度都一样。而list的查找速度随着元素增加而逐渐下降。 dict的第二个特点就是存储的key-value序对是没有顺序的!这和list不一样: dict的第三个特点是作为 key 的元素必须不可变,Python的基本类型如字符串、整数、浮点数都是不可变的,都可以作为 key。但是list是可变的,就不能作为 key。
    查看全部
  • dict的第一个特点是查找速度快,无论dict有10个元素还是10万个元素,查找速度都一样。而list的查找速度随着元素增加而逐渐下降。 dict的第二个特点就是存储的key-value序对是没有顺序的!这和list不一样: dict的第三个特点是作为 key 的元素必须不可变,Python的基本类型如字符串、整数、浮点数都是不可变的,都可以作为 key。但是list是可变的,就不能作为 key。
    查看全部
  • a = 'python' print 'hello,', a or 'world' b = '' print 'hello,', b or 'world' #Python把0、空字符串''和None看成False,其他数值和非空字符串看成True a=True print a and 'a=T' or 'a=T' #在计算a and b时,若a 是false,则结果为False,返回a;若a 为True,则结果取决于b,返回b。 #在计算 a or b时,若a为True,结果为True,返回a;若a为False,结果取决于b,返回b。
    查看全部
  • print 2.5 + 10.0 / 4 #整数和浮点数混合运算的结果是浮点数 #11%4 Python提供了%求余数 # 括号的使用可以嵌套
    查看全部
  • 用 for 循环或者 while 循环时,如果要在循环体内直接退出循环,可以使用 break 语句。
    查看全部
  • 1、set存储的是一组不重复的无序元素 2、更新set主要做两件事: 一是把新的元素添加到set中,用set的add()方法,如果添加的元素已经存在于set中,add()不会报错,但是不会加进去了。 二是把已有元素从set中删除,用set的remove()方法,如果删除的元素不存在set中,remove()会报错。add()可以直接添加,而remove()前需要判断
    查看全部
    0 采集 收起 来源:Python之 更新set

    2018-01-19

  • L=[] for x in range(1,101): v=x*x L.append(v) print sum(L)
    查看全部
  • 由于 set 也是一个集合,所以,遍历 set 和遍历 list 类似,都可以通过 for 循环实现
    查看全部
    0 采集 收起 来源:Python之 遍历set

    2018-01-19

  • isinstance(x, str) 可以判断变量 x 是否是字符串;
    查看全部
    0 采集 收起 来源:条件过滤

    2018-01-19

  • 1、set的内部结构和dict很像,唯一区别是不存储value 2、set存储的元素和dict的key类似,必须是不变对象 3、set存储的元素也是没有顺序的
    查看全部
  • 1、由于set存储的是无序集合,所以我们没法通过索引来访问。访问 set中的某个元素实际上就是判断一个元素是否在set中。可以用 in 操作符判断。大小写很重要,'Bart' 和 'bart'被认为是两个不同的元素。
    查看全部
    0 采集 收起 来源:Python之 访问set

    2018-01-19

  • 1、dict的作用是建立一组 key 和一组 value 的映射关系,dict的key是不能重复的。 2、set 持有一系列元素,这一点和 list 很像,但是set的元素没有重复,而且是无序的,这点和 dict 的 key很像。 3、创建 set 的方式是调用 set() 并传入一个 list,list的元素将作为set的元素 4、set内部存储的元素是无序的 5、因为set不能包含重复的元素,所以,当我们传入包含重复元素的 list 时set会自动去掉重复的元素
    查看全部
  • 这节课还是得好好学啊
    查看全部
    0 采集 收起 来源:复杂表达式

    2018-01-19

  • 由于dict也是一个集合,所以,遍历dict和遍历list类似,都可以通过 for 循环实现。
    查看全部

举报

0/150
提交
取消
课程须知
如果您了解程序设计的基本概念,会简单使用命令行,了解中学数学函数的概念,那么对课程学习会有很大的帮助,让您学起来得心应手,快速进入Python世界。
老师告诉你能学到什么?
通过本课程的学习,您将学会搭建基本的Python开发环境,以函数为基础编写完整的Python代码,熟练掌握Python的基本数据类型以及list和dict的操作。
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!